Timestamped Summary

00:00 Octavia Butler's visionary fiction serves as a catalyst for reflection on societal issues and personal change.
06:25 Octavia Butler's science fiction intertwines personal narrative with broader societal issues through her visionary storytelling and historical perspective.
12:55 Ayana Jamison found personal healing in Octavia Butler's writing, which mirrored her own experiences as a black woman growing up poor in California during the Depression.
18:20 Octavia Butler found solace in creating intricate worlds within stories, which paralleled her personal narrative of resilience as a black woman from the Depression era.
24:06 Octavia Butler disrupts conventional sci-fi by integrating African culture and spirituality, emphasizing resilience through her unique visionary fiction.
30:22 Octavia Butler's unique visionary fiction draws from African culture and spirituality to inspire resilience in the sci-fi genre.
35:37 Octavia Butler channels her personal experiences of racial identity into science fiction, creating resilient characters navigating immortality and colonialism.
41:53 Octavia Butler’s "Wild Seed" challenges binaries of gender and identity through complex characters who defy societal norms.
47:28 Octavia Butler's "Parable of the Sower" is an apocalyptic coming-of-age novel about a teen girl seeking survival amid societal collapse, inspired by California's conservative political shifts and anti-tax sentiments.
53:51 Octavia Butler envisions a dystopian future where societal collapse leads to extreme stratification and environmental catastrophes.
59:36 Octavia Butler’s Parable of the Sower illustrates a dystopian future where societal collapse and environmental disaster compel characters to form communal bonds, reflecting on themes of power, resilience, survival, and hope amidst adversity.
01:05:24 Octavia E. Butler, a transformative science fiction writer who inspired countless with her visionary work and profound reflections on society and humanity, tragically passed away before completing Parable of the Sower's third novel.
